C语言读取MySQL数据库文件指南

资源类型:iis7.top 2025-06-11 11:23

c mysql 读取 数据库文件简介:



C语言与MySQL:高效读取数据库文件的深度解析 在当今信息化时代,数据库管理系统的应用无处不在,从简单的个人信息管理到复杂的企业级数据仓库,数据库都扮演着举足轻重的角色

    MySQL,作为开源数据库管理系统中的佼佼者,凭借其高性能、可靠性和易用性,赢得了广泛的用户基础

    而在C语言这一经典且强大的编程语言中,与MySQL数据库的交互更是开发高效、底层应用的关键所在

    本文将深入探讨如何使用C语言读取MySQL数据库文件,通过具体步骤和示例代码,展现这一过程的强大与高效

     一、为什么选择C语言与MySQL结合 1. 性能优势 C语言以其接近硬件的执行效率和灵活的内存管理能力著称,这使得它在处理大量数据、执行频繁I/O操作时表现出色

    MySQL虽然提供了多种编程语言接口(如PHP、Python、Java等),但C语言接口(MySQL C API)能够最直接地利用MySQL的性能优势,实现高效的数据读写

     2. 底层控制 在需要精确控制数据库操作或优化性能的场景下,C语言提供了无与伦比的底层控制能力

    开发者可以直接管理内存、优化数据结构、甚至实现自定义的加密解密逻辑,这些在高级语言中往往难以实现或效率低下

     3. 系统级集成 许多操作系统级别的服务或工具,尤其是那些对性能要求极高的应用,如数据库引擎本身、高性能网络服务器等,往往采用C语言开发

    C语言与MySQL的结合,便于这些系统级应用的深度集成,实现无缝的数据交互

     二、准备工作 在正式编写代码之前,需要做好以下准备工作: 1. 安装MySQL 确保你的系统上已经安装了MySQL数据库服务器

    可以通过MySQL官方网站下载安装包,或者使用包管理器(如apt-get、yum)在Linux上安装

     2. 安装MySQL C API开发库 MySQL C API通常包含在MySQL Server的开发包中

    安装MySQL Server时,可以选择包含开发库的安装选项,或者单独安装MySQL Development Library

     3. 配置开发环境 确保你的C编译器能够找到MySQL C API的头文件和库文件

    通常,这需要在编译时指定包含目录和库目录

     三、连接MySQL数据库 使用C语言与MySQL交互的第一步是建立数据库连接

    MySQL C API提供了一套完整的函数集,用于管理数据库连接、执行SQL语句和处理结果集

     示例代码:建立数据库连接 include include include int main() { MYSQLconn; MYSQL_RESres; MYSQL_ROW row; // 初始化MySQL库 mysql_library_init(0, NULL, NULL);

阅读全文
上一篇:MySQL误删数据?别急,这里有高效恢复指南!

最新收录:

  • MySQL DATE类型数据处理技巧
  • MySQL误删数据?别急,这里有高效恢复指南!
  • MySQL版本分表策略解析
  • MySQL中OR与LIKE优化技巧揭秘
  • MySQL安装:打造高效data文件夹指南
  • MySQL数据库高效执行INSERT操作技巧
  • 如何在MySQL中设置字符集:详细指南
  • Linux下如何修改MySQL配置文件指南
  • MySQL8.0.3 my.ini优化配置指南
  • 如何扩大MySQL TEXT字段容量
  • CentOS系统下MySQL 5.6安装全教程
  • MySQL小数类型详解与应用
  • 首页 | c mysql 读取 数据库文件:C语言读取MySQL数据库文件指南